Our oenologists' opinion

Powerful bouquet

Dark garnet colour with brick tints. Open nose, mentholated, notes of blond tobacco, spices and cigar, hint of leather. Supple attack, with smoky notes, tension, long and fat tannins, small envelope. Character on candied pepper and spices, mineral touch. Powerful, full-bodied finish on dark chocolate and candied pepper, nice persistence on old leather.

Domain and appellation

  • CHÂTEAU LA LAGUNE 2015

    Classified as a 3rd Grand Cru in 1855, Château La Lagune dates back to the 18th century with the Seguineau family. In 1999, the Frey family bought Château La Lagune, and it was Caroline Frey who created the Mademoiselle L wine when she took over the management of the estate in 2004.

        Terroir: The 80-hectare estate lies on gravelly hilltops.
        Viticulture: The estate practices integrated viticulture. The grapes are harvested by hand.
        Vinification: A parcel-based vinification is favoured. The wine is aged for 18 months in French oak barrels (55% new).
